How to connect Bubble and AI: Text-To-Speech

Create a New Scenario to Connect Bubble and AI: Text-To-Speech

In the workspace, click the β€œCreate New Scenario” button.

Add the First Step

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a Bubble, triggered by another scenario, or executed manually (for testing purposes). In most cases, Bubble or AI: Text-To-Speech will be your first step. To do this, click "Choose an app," find Bubble or AI: Text-To-Speech, and select the appropriate trigger to start the scenario.

Save and Activate the Scenario

After configuring Bubble, AI: Text-To-Speech,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.

Test the Scenario

Run the scenario by clicking β€œRun once” and triggering an event to check if the Bubble and AI: Text-To-Speech integration works as expected. Depending on your setup, data should flow between Bubble and AI: Text-To-Speech (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.

Are there any limitations to the Bubble and AI: Text-To-Speech integration on Latenode?

While the integration is powerful, there are certain limitations to be aware of:

  • AI: Text-To-Speech API rate limits may affect large-scale audio generation.
  • Complex Bubble data structures may require custom JavaScript transformations.
  • Audio quality is dependent on the chosen AI: Text-To-Speech service.
